Ingredients

Vodka sauce 1.jpg

  • Tomatoes, crushed or puree. I also added a drained can of diced, for texture.
  • Vodka!
  • Half and half or cream
  • Onion
  • Garlic
  • Oregano
  • Fresh Basil
  • Pepper Flakes
  • Mushrooms (not pictured, they were hiding in my fridge!)
  • Salt, Pepper
  • Parmesan

Method

Chop your onion, mushrooms, and garlic if you're not using a press or something. Brown the onion for a minute or two, then add the mushrooms and garlic, and brown over high heat (I also used the same pan as the chicken, for extra yummy fond)

Add the can(s) of tomatoes, some red pepper flakes, oregano, salt and pepper.

Cook that puppy for a while, so it reduces a good amount. You'll be adding a lot more liquid in the vodka and cream at the end, so you'll want it thick. Your pasta water should be boiling by now too, so cook that stuff!

Add about a half to 3/4 of a cup of vodka. Cook for at least 5 minutes over medium heat. Add about a cup of whichever dairy product you choose to use, and simmer gently for another few minutes till it's all together and yummy. (chicken pictured from original recipe)

Chop or tear your basil, and add at the last minute, just to wilt it. MMM, basil.
